We're talking about skateboarding parts and maintenance. Today we're going to talk about
truck maintenance. Tightening and loosing the trucks is important to having your complete
skateboard adjusted to your preferred settings. Tighter trucks means it's harder to turn looser
trucks means it's easier to turn. To tighten trucks use the appropriate size wrench turn
the nut on top of the king pin truck in a clockwise position. Turning it in a clockwise
position will tightening the trucks and cause them more resistant to turning. Loosing the
trucks will provide opposite effect making them looser and easier to turn. The most important
thing is having your trucks almost equally balance but some people prefer differences
in their trucks. I for example like to ride my back trucks slightly tighter than my front
trucks, the front trucks do more of the turning so having a looser front truck means I can
turn easier by leaning without having to always use the tail. Most importantly make sure your
trucks are about as loose or even as each other. You can do this by backing the nuts
completely off and inserting them and counting the number of rotations you made on the actual
nut.
